WebThe neighbor next-hop-self command causes the router to change the BGP NEXT_HOP attribute to its own loopback address in all eBGP routes advertised to the specified iBGP neighbor. It is useful when the IGP knows how to get to the border router but does not know how to get to an external facing address.
